What are Polysaccharides?

Respuesta :

shwtymaxx
shwtymaxx shwtymaxx
  • 23-02-2022

Polysaccharides are long chains of monosaccharides linked by glycosidic bonds. Three important polysaccharides, starch, glycogen, and cellulose, are composed of glucose. Starch and glycogen serve as short-term energy stores in plants and animals, respectively. The glucose monomers are linked by α glycosidic bonds.
